Musk’s involvement in the 2024 election extended far beyond flashy endorsements. His America PAC poured nearly $300 million into the battleground states, leveraging advanced messaging strategies and the reach of X to engineer strategic voter influence. While Trump commanded the stage, Musk controlled the backstage, shaping narrative arcs with precision. That campaign muscle powered by Silicon Valley optics helped catapult JD Vance, then Trump’s running mate, into the vice presidency. Musk’s campaign infrastructure evolved into a potent political tool, forging a bond with Vance that is equal parts ideology and necessity.
